I offer the following to maybe assist a Crafter owner. I am a career tech with VW & Bosch training in the 1980’s
We owned a 2009 Crafter based Motorhome with the Shiftmatic transmission which is an automated manual, automation by Eton Magnetti Morelli. Similar transmission found in the early Sprinters and called a Sprintshift. It was a great vehicle with an all up weight of approx 4500 kgs. At approx 84,000 kms the Shiftmatic transmission played up. Through diagnosis I identified that the concentric release bearing sensor had an open circuit. On removal of the transmission I found dual mass flywheel had also failed. Purchased replacement parts through a LUK dealer in the UK, big mistake as it turned out they supplied the wrong kit.On assembly the issue still existed and the transmission would not drive.
Use of my own ODIS would not get the clutch to relearn the bite point etc. Long story short, VW dealer and new parts saw the vehicle back to normal after 6 months of dealer incompetence. Travelling an additional 45,000kms without issue after we later sold it as life plans changed.
